Mouthing e mouth gesture nella lingua dei segni italiana. Descrizione, consapevolezza e acquisizione di un fenomeno ubiquo, complesso e dibattuto
What and how do signers labialize in the act of signing? Is labialization related to the interface between form and rhythm of the sign? What do signers think about this phenomenon? Are oral components considered in LIS (Italian Sign Language) teaching? These are some of the ques- tions that we posed and attempted to answer. To shed light on such a controversial phenomenon, a questionnaire was designed and disseminated online. It involved over 273 deaf and hearing signers from all over Italy.
